Buying Advice for Your KitchenAid Classic

When selecting accessories for your KitchenAid Classic, prioritize compatibility with your specific model to ensure a perfect fit and optimal performance. Durable materials like stainless steel extend the lifespan of your attachments and improve reliability.

Consider your typical baking needs—heavy-duty paddles are better for dense doughs, while lighter paddles suffice for standard cake batters. Also, look for dishwasher-safe features for easier cleanup and maintenance.

Key Features to Look for in KitchenAid Accessories

Focus on materials that resist chipping and bending, such as stainless steel. Compatibility with your mixer model is essential, especially for tilt-head designs that require precise fitting. Lastly, evaluate the versatility of attachments—some paddles are specialized, while others are multipurpose.

Frequently Asked Questions

Are KitchenAid accessories dishwasher safe?

Most stainless steel attachments, including paddles like the one reviewed, are dishwasher safe, making cleanup convenient.

Can I use these paddles for heavy doughs?

Yes, heavy-duty stainless steel paddles are designed to handle thick doughs and dense batters without bending or breaking.

Are these paddles compatible with all KitchenAid mixers?

No, compatibility depends on the model. The paddles reviewed are specifically designed for 4.5-5 Qt tilt-head models like the Classic, Artisan, and Classic Plus series.

How do I know if a paddle fits my KitchenAid mixer?

Check the model number of your mixer and ensure it matches the compatibility listed on the paddle or attachment packaging.
